Pushing The Lens: Conceptual Practices in Photography
An ongoing series of lectures by artists who use photography to investigate subjects ranging from identity to history; ethnography and cataloguing; collecting, consuming and desire. They are disparate in their approaches but each photographer plays with the boundaries of the medium to different ends. Each artist will share their experience for the benefit of the School of Arts students but their practices will demonstrate how contemporary photography and the humanities or the sciences can collide.
